Like Marco, I would suggest using logspace. For example,
logspace(1,3,10)
creates a vector of 10 logarithmically spaced values between 10^1 and 10^3. If you instead want the bounds to be determined by a value and not the exponent, I generally use the following:
logspace(log10(3),log10(10),10)
This will create a vector of 10 logarithmically spaced values between 3 and 10.
